Durga Puja Photo Walk and Photo Contest-2017

Sharodiyo Durga Puja, the largest religious festival of Hindu religion.

We are going to organize an event called “Durga Puja Photo Walk and Photo Contest-2017” from Bangladesh Local Guides. In this event, there will be two-part. One Photo Walk and another is Contest on the submitted photo. That means there will be a competition in terms of the pictures you give. Everyone can participate in Contest.

Participation in Contest must be kept in mind.

1. Photos can be of anything that reflects the Puja vibe, such as the idol itself, or the stage, or the crowd, or the offerings in front of the idol…anything and everything that symbolizes the Durga Puja.
2. Images can be taken with any device. For example, Mobile, DSLR etc. The pictures have to be your original pictures, taken by you, one of the local guides, not by any professional photographer. If you are selected, you will have to prove the originality of the photo.
3. We’ll make a folder in Google Drive. There you will have to submit photos in a separate folder with your name. The folder must be named as your Google Account Name. And three of your captured photo should be posted on our Event Page. Add your name, photo number, photo captions with the uploaded photos. But no more than 3 photos.
4. No pictures will be accepted for the contest if they are added in the folder after 1 October midnight, GMT+6.
5. The hashtag must be followed vigilantly. #Sharodiyo17. If you fail to use the hashtag properly or if there is any spelling error, your photo might be disqualified for the contest, even if it was the best photo. So, to be on the safe side, I would just copy and paste the hashtag from here.
6. The photos will be judged by a panel of professional photographer/s and critic.
7. None of the organizers or their family members are eligible to take part in the contest.
